The Pharmacology of Temazepam: How It Induces Sleep

Temazepam is a central nervous system (CNS) depressant. Like other benzodiazepines, it exerts its effects by enhancing the function of g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A), the brain’s primary inhibitory neurotransmitter. By binding to specific sites on the GABA-A receptor complex, temazepam increases the influx of chloride ions into neurons. This hyperpolarizes the cell membrane, effectively reducing the excitability of nerve cells.

In clinical practice, this translates to a faster onset of sleep and an increase in total sleep time. Because it is classified as a “short-to-intermediate” acting benzodiazepine, it is specifically indicated for the short-term treatment of insomnia that is severe, disabling, or causing the patient extreme distress.

Clinical Indications and Proper Administration

Medical professionals prescribe temazepam with a clear understanding that it is a temporary bridge, not a permanent solution. Guidelines in countries such as Canada, Germany, France, the Netherlands, Switzerland, Finland, and Austria generally recommend that treatment duration be as short as possible—often not exceeding two to four weeks—including a tapering-off period.

Proper administration is crucial. Temazepam should be taken immediately before bedtime, as it induces drowsiness rapidly. Patients are advised to ensure they have a full 7 to 8 hours available for sleep to avoid “hangover” effects, such as residual grogginess, impaired coordination, or cognitive slowing the following morning.

Global Regulatory Context and Safety

Temazepam is a controlled substance worldwide. In regions with highly restrictive narcotics policies, such as Dubai and the UAE, the medication is treated with extreme caution, requiring specific medical authorization.

The risks associated with benzodiazepines are well-documented:

  • Tolerance: The brain adapts to the medication, meaning higher doses may be required over time to achieve the same effect.
  • Dependence: Physical dependence can develop even within a few weeks of consistent use.
  • Withdrawal: Abrupt cessation after prolonged use can trigger rebound insomnia, anxiety, and in severe cases, withdrawal seizures.
  • Synergistic Effects: Combining temazepam with alcohol or opioids is extremely dangerous and can lead to fatal respiratory depression.
